Network Mapping Software

Network mapping software is a robust tool designed to enable users to visualize and assess their computer networks through detailed mapping. It offers an extensive view of the network's architecture, presenting all connected devices, the links between them, and how they rely on each other. Such software is essential for network administrators and IT professionals in gaining understanding of network efficiency, spotting security risks, and in strategizing for prospective network growth or modernization. By using this software, users have the capability to produce intricate maps illustrating network structures, IP address assignments, and the operational state of each device. This facilitates more effective problem-solving, better allocation of network resources, and allows for a forward-thinking approach to managing the network. What is network mapping software?

This is a tool that is designed to help individuals and organizations discover and map all the devices connected to their network. It is essentially a visual representation of all the components in their network and their relationships with each other. This software is becoming increasingly popular in today's world due to the growing complexity of computer networks and the need for better visibility and control.

Some of its common use cases include:

  • Network monitoring: By mapping your network architecture, you can easily monitor the status of your network devices, track their performance metrics, and troubleshoot issues as they arise.
  • Security auditing: Mapping your network is critical for ensuring security. With network mapping software, you can identify vulnerabilities, identify potential security threats, and take preventative measures to secure your network.
  • Planning and expansion: The system is also useful for planning out network expansions or migrating to new systems. With the help of network mapping software, IT teams can streamline the process of adding new devices, networks, or locations.
  • Asset management: IT teams can also use it to keep track of all connected devices to their network. This is critical for ensuring the organization is compliant with regulations, managing inventory, and planning out upgrades.

10 key features of network mapping software

Here are 10 common features you can expect to find in a network mapping platform:

1. Discovery and mapping:

Network mapping software allows you to discover and map all devices on your network, including computers, routers, switches, printers, and other network-enabled devices.

2. Performance monitoring:

The program comes with real-time network device monitoring where you can detect bandwidth usage, performance, connectivity issues, and other errors.

3. Network traffic analysis:

Some network mapping software solutions offer the ability to capture and analyze network traffic, giving you greater insight into network behavior and identifying potential problems.

4. Network topology:

Companies are able to create detailed maps of their network topology, including physical and logical connections between devices, to visualize and understand network architecture.

5. Asset management:

It enables you to keep track of your network assets including both hardware and software components.

6. Configuration management:

A wide range of systems offer configuration management to monitor and archive network device configurations, allowing for easier network restoration or device replacement.

7. Reporting:

The tool allows you to generate detailed reports in real-time, including device inventory, performance, and status.

8. Security management:

Mapping software can help you to identify potential vulnerabilities and monitor network security threats such as unauthorized access attempts, DDoS attacks, and other malicious activity.

9. Historical tracking:

A network mapping application allows you to keep track of previous network changes or configurations.

10. Integration with other tools:

Many tools support integration with other networking tools, such as performance monitors, intrusion detection systems, and security event management tools.

Things to consider when purchasing a network mapping tool

When it comes to managing a network, one of the most important tasks is to understand its topology and all of the devices that are connected to it. When considering purchasing a network mapping package, there are several factors that businesses should take into account. 

  1. Firstly, it is important to consider the scale of your network. Smaller networks may not require advanced network mapping features, whereas larger networks will require more robust solutions to manage their complexity.
  2. Another key factor to consider is the level of automation offered by the system. A user-friendly interface that simplifies the process of network discovery is a valuable feature. An automated scanning and mapping process requires minimal intervention by network admins. Additionally, businesses should consider the software’s capability to track the changes in real-time to provide an up-to-date visual representation of the network.
  3. The ability of a network solution to interoperate with other network management tools is another factor to consider carefully. Enhanced functionality such as service monitoring and alerting integration add more value to the business so that your IT team can provide better customer support.
  4. Furthermore, the level of customization to fit your business requirements is crucial when contemplating a network mapping app. The software should allow you to add custom fields to assets which helps to categorize and filter assets as per business-specific requirements. Also, find out if the solution can be integrated with asset management tools to track asset lifecycle management with ease.
  5. Lastly, it is important to assess the vendor's support and maintenance options. Ensure that the vendor provides an extensive library of documentation for troubleshooting the solution. Similarly, the vendor should be reachable via email, phone or ticketing system, especially when your team encounters tech hitches.
